Publication number: 20240116574Abstract: A motor vehicle having a bearing structure, which includes a shell having a crossbeam, which is integrated into the bearing structure with its opposite ends between two B-pillars. A respective side impact support is combined with a crash pad between the opposite ends of the crossbeam and the B-pillars, which side impact support constitutes a second load path emanating from the affected B-pillar in case of a side impact, which is provided in addition to a first load path, which extends from the B-pillar into the crossbeam via the respective side impact support in case of a side impact.Type: ApplicationFiled: September 6, 2023Publication date: April 11, 2024Applicant: Dr. Ing. h.c. Patent number: 11332193Abstract: A crossmember arrangement for reinforcing a motor-vehicle body includes a crossmember for dissipating loads in the Y direction, an intermediate piece, which is connected directly or indirectly to the crossmember and is intended for fastening the crossmember to a supporting pillar, in particular a B pillar, and a fastening body, which is connected to the intermediate piece and is intended for butting with surface-area contact against the supporting pillar. The fastening body is configured in the form of a chamber profile which runs predominantly in the Y direction. Dissipation of high loads in a motor-vehicle body is made possible, along with straightforward installation capability of the crossmember arrangement in the motor-vehicle body, as a result of the fastening body of the crossmember arrangement, the fastening body is configured in the form of a chamber profile, running essentially in the Y direction.Type: GrantFiled: March 19, 2020Date of Patent: May 17, 2022Inventors: Hans-Jürgen Schmitt, Björn Dunst

Patent number: 10800367Abstract: A coupling link (18) for a hinged roll bar (12) has first and second cover plates (24, 26) spaced apart from each other. An axle bearing (32, 50) is connected to the two cover plates (24) for forming a rotary joint (40) with a first link lever (14) that can be mounted on the axle bearing (32, 50). The coupling link (18) has, in the region of the rotary joint (40), a reinforcing element (42) that forms a support of the first link lever (14).Type: GrantFiled: July 9, 2018Date of Patent: October 13, 2020Assignee: Dr. Ing. h.c. Patent number: 10363894Abstract: A rollover protection device (1) for a passenger car has a supporting device (3) that extends vertically when installed properly. A crossmember (5) is secured on the supporting device (3) and extends in a lateral direction (4) when installed properly. The crossmember (5) is of beam-shaped design and comprises a die-cast, low-pressure die-cast or forged unit (6).Type: GrantFiled: June 14, 2017Date of Patent: July 30, 2019Assignee: Dr. Ing. h.c. F. Patent number: 9783146Abstract: A rollover protection system for a motor vehicle has a profiled strut (3) extending in the direction of a vertical axis (6) of the vehicle, and a deformation element (4) held at a first end (9) of the profiled strut (3). The first end (9) is formed facing away from a vehicle floor of the motor vehicle, and the deformation element (4) has a first outer surface (10) facing away from the profiled strut (3) to form an impact surface. The deformation element (4) has a breaking element (11) in the form of a cutting roller.Type: GrantFiled: May 11, 2016Date of Patent: October 10, 2017Assignee: DR. ING H.C.F. Patent number: 9610914Abstract: A rollover protection element (4) having a rollover element (5, 10, 110, 210) of elongate configuration and a bumper element (6, 11, 111, 211) connected at a free end of the rollover element (5, 10, 110, 210). The bumper element (6, 11, 111, 211) extends in a width direction of the rollover element (5, 10, 110, 210). The bumper element (6, 11, 111, 211) has a circumferential-side wall and webs that are arranged within the wall, a lower-side region of the wall of the bumper element (6, 11, 111, 211) is connected to the rollover element (5, 10, 110, 210). The webs are arranged in a curved and/inclined manner such that none of the webs lies perpendicularly on the lower-side region of the wall.Type: GrantFiled: March 2, 2016Date of Patent: April 4, 2017Assignee: Dr. Ing. h.c.
